A Brief History of Denmark - Local Histories

WebMar 14, 2024 · Denmark grew steadily richer. Trade in the Baltic region prospered and Danish towns grew larger and more important. However, in 1349-1350 Denmark, like the rest of Europe was devastated by the Black Death, which probably killed 1/3 of the population. WebNov 3, 2024 · Norway kept the Norwegian krone, Sweden the Swedish krona and Denmark the Danish krone. Coins originally came in physical denominations of 10 and 50 øre and 1 krone and 10-krone coins, but when the coins were introduced in full between 1875 and 1878, 1, 2, 5, 10, 25 and 50 øre and 1, 2 and 10-krone coins were introduced.
